Your Team

Reporting to the Group Customs Manager, you will manage an area providing customs support excellence to all aspects of Debenhams group’s supply chain, from B&M guidance & the customs support for delivery of international customer parcels & returns as well as product & documentation compliance to our wholesale partners.

The department has successfully managed the implementation of a customs bonded warehouse operation at our Burnley DC and will soon embark on a similar project for the Sheffield facility.

The Role

This newly created role, will play a pivotal role in ensuring compliance with international customs regulations and optimising duty costs. This role involves collaborating with suppliers to ensure accurate information for customs declarations whilst educating them on customs requirements and changes. You'll handle international customs-related issues, disputes, and investigations as well as developing strategies to resolve trade-related challenges.

You must have a good understanding of global trade regulations and tariff classifications and be able to provide insights on market access and regulatory implications whilst also identifying opportunities for process enhancement and trade process automation.
